Hello everyone,

I can't seem to find an definitive answer to this question: What is the most secure way to make a backup of my 'backup drive' for my Wii U. Before I convert/inject my Wii games into VC - which is a time consuming process - I would like to know if I am able to make a backup, since HDD won't last forever.

If I make a manual backup from the Wii U setting will this include all games - also the injected ones - so that I can swap the drive if/when the original drive fails.

Yes, copying from within Wii U settings (Data Manager) is possible! Cloning via PC is NOT due to the Wii U encrypting the content with HDD serial number included.

You can't make a backup of your Wii U HD. There is no way to clone it 1:1. You have to setup a second HD and manually copy everything over from Wii U data management.

Yes and the Wii U encrypts each HDD using its own unique hardware id, so a HDD clone using Windows is useless. Simply use the Wii U to copy games from a HDD to another.
